Simulation error considering MXNX,MXNY,MXNZ

Hello!

I tried a simulation of a gold nanorod with size 41.1nm X 14.3nm (SHPAR1=26.8, SHPAR=14.3) with shape file: Cylinder with End-Caps. 

But it crushed every time at the very beginning.

The crush log is as following:

>>>>> FATAL ERROR IN PROCEDURE: EXTEND
>>>>>  need to change MXNX,MXNY,MXNZ in DDSCAT and recompile
>>>>> EXECUTION ABORTED

 

And the last part of the output log is as following:

>TARGET: Cyl.prism, NAT=   5932 NFAC= 164 NLAY=  27 asp.ratio= 1.8685      
           5932 = NAT0 = number of dipoles in target
 >DDSCAT returned from TARGET:                                                 
 >DDSCAT : dimensions of physical target                                       
 >DDSCAT     -6    34 = min, max values of JX                                  
 >DDSCAT     -6     7 = min, max values of JY                                  
 >DDSCAT     -6     7 = min, max values of JZ                                  
 >DDSCAT  -14.00000  -0.50000  -0.50000 = X0(1-3)                              
 >DDSCAT  --- physical extent of target volume (occupied sites) ---            
 >DDSCAT    -20.50000    20.50000 = min, max values of x/d                     
 >DDSCAT     -7.00000     7.00000 = min, max values of y/d                     
 >DDSCAT     -7.00000     7.00000 = min, max values of z/d                     
 >EXTEND target extent in x,y,z directions =   41,   14,   14 (in Target Frame)
 >EXTEND: Fatal error after extending target!:
          Extended target extent in x,y,z directions =   45,   15,   15
          exceeds dimension limits MXNX,MXNY,MXNZ=   42,   15,   15

 

I have tried several different sizes but they all failed.

Is there any solution? Thank you for the help!

    We have currently just published version 1.7f of our nanoDDSCAT tool. I highly recommend re-running your simulations with Cylinders. We have added support for non-integer values and I have been able to successfully run a Cylinder with End-Caps using SHPAR1=26.8, SHPAR2=14.3
